Business Economics examines economic principles relevant to contemporary business practices, fostering a comprehensive understanding of resource allocation challenges faced by corporations and their operating environments. Students will explore foundational concepts in microeconomics and macroeconomics, while applying these theories and models to real-world business decisions.
